#ab6e59 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#ab6e59 is composed of 67.1% red, 43.1%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 35.7% magenta, 48% yellow and 32.9% black. It has a hue angle of 15.4 degrees, a saturation of 32.8% and a lightness of 51%. #ab6e59 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ffdcb2 with #570000. Closest websafe color is: #996666.

Shades and Tints of #ab6e59

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030202 is the darkest color, while #faf7f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#ab6e59

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#85817f is the less saturated color, while #f8480c is the most saturated one.
